New insight into foregut functions of xenobiotic detoxification in the cockroach Periplaneta americana

The physiological functions of insect foregut,especially in xenobiotic detox ification,are scarcely reported because of unimportance in appearance and insufficient molecular information.The cockroach Periplaneta americana,an entomological model organism,provides perfect material to study physiological functions of foregut tissue due to its architectuxal feature.Through Illumina sequencing of foregut tissue from P.amer icana individuals (control)or insects treated with cycloxaprid,as a novel neonicotinoid insecticide,54 193 166 clean reads were obtained and further assembled into 53 853 unigenes with an average length of 366 bp.Furthermore,the number of unigenes involved in xenobiofic detoxification was analyzed,mainly including 70 cytochrome P450s,12 glutathione S-transferases (GSTs),seven carboxylesterases (CarEs)and seven adenosine triphosphate-binding cassette (ABC)transporters.Compared to control,the expression of 22 xenobiotic detoxification unigenes was up-regulated after cycloxaprid application, mainly containing 18 P450s,one GST,two CarEs and one ABC adenosine triphosphate transporter,indicating that the oxidation-reduction was the major reactive process to cy cloxaprid application.Through quantitative real-time polymerase chitin reaction analysis, the expression of selected unigenes (six P450s,one GST and one CarE.)was up-regulated at least two-fold following cycloxaprid treatment,and was generally in agreement with transcriptome data.Compared to the previous midgut transcriptome of P.americana,it looks like the expressive abundance of the xenobiotic detoxification unigenes might be important factors to the detoxifying fimctional differences between foregut and midgut.In conclusion,insect foregut would also play important roles in the physiological processes related to xenobiotic detoxification. 展开更多
